Type
ORACLE
Validation date
2025-07-22 15:37: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(38 B)

{
  "uco": {
    "eur": 2.523e-4,
    "usd": 2.96e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C7AB54203152DD7295FEBE47068263A914E3A83A6897383BD840221124A7C99D

Previous signature

91D63B5ED59D29595756E8CE8456BF9E08EF6A6CE8478EDACE59D37E9FD44084F0259599A4F65F4987569AA49EEF626A0ACE9C6B3A767C8A77EBFC0E422C0500

Origin signature

3045022100E576BDB6D446657417E18444B755EC710B1A07D91E675A7DEDB059676781EDB1022063E9B159DE57AC1BC7C58694880AD37B7C1D8F9165CEE0EEFB213E257698C11C

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

008F841076D7FB757A8EFC202B7A20CC27C9A1BB598728F4A88A0E68891830DE97

Coordinator signature

6D826BC14B839B576047D79F783362555DD208D59C5054FF8FC50860D4E4E32F935EDE5DCF3E2CD48AC7B5E6AA3BE914422748E123483A158FEA0599771F3505

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

223500CC97289BE9B3AD8DDCEBCD630E65EF4AA5B4E761FE2AD7B905298C11BDF7191EBAAA218EDA7285B226D24257628F203C16FB91F1BDF54FE4C8F365F800

Validator #2 public key

000197CC2A01ACC6B1005CB9F1730A3453E682100552386A1720F7107DC70625B05E

Validator #2 signature

72968569EF8D816A1935167C16676063E38335DD8292748C61DB5FFAC7866A70C785BA8A8215BE87162A5FED1EADF9F2BF19C419ECAA74A92084C3B2FFEE7F0C